OMC3 is our main framework for beam optics measurements and corrections in circular particle accelerators.
It provides tools for frequency analysis of turn-by-turn data, optics measurements, correction calculations, accelerator model creation and related analysis workflows.
| Project | Description | Version | Coverage |
|---|---|---|---|
| omc3 | Beam optics measurements, frequency analysis and corrections | ||
| tfs | Read, write and manipulate CERN TFS files | ||
| optics_functions | Linear and non-linear accelerator optics calculations | ||
| turn_by_turn | Read, write and manipulate turn-by-turn BPM data | ||
| sdds | Read and write Self Describing Data Sets (SDDS) files | ||
| omc3_gui | Graphical interface for OMC3 Segment-by-Segment analysis | — |
